Re: enabling permessage-deflate on the Fennelwire gateway — be careful here. Compression cuts our frame sizes ~60% but the per-connection context memory adds up fast at our connection counts, and CPU spikes during reconnect storms. We compromise: compress only frames above a size threshold, and cap context takeover windows. New folks, read the gateway runbook before touching this. Current tuning values are pinned below so changes show up in diffs.

tuning table, yajog-yahof:
BUDGETS = {
    "lamvan": 303,
    "wenox": 460,
    "fenvan": 525,
}

Finance Review Summary — Hedging Decision

Reviewed Q3 exposure on the Velran crown following the Osterfeld expansion. Forward contracts locked for 70% of projected receivables; remainder floats per Tavrin's model. Cost of carry acceptable; downside capped at tolerance threshold. No objections from treasury. Decision stands through year-end unless volatility doubles. The strategic rationale behind the partial hedge is noted below.

confidential, bahop-hahif: Only 3 of the 140 pilot accounts renewed Oliath, so a churn review is set for July 15.

At peak it emits around 40k log lines per minute, and the aggregator in the Dovebrook cluster starts lagging above 25k. We're enabling adaptive sampling: debug lines get sampled hardest, warnings lightly, errors never. On-call should expect sampled traces in dashboards and use the request-id fallback for full fidelity on flagged requests. Storage projections show this keeps us under quota through next quarter without new nodes. The sampling constants going live with the next deploy are shown below.

limits module of fajog-tawig:
RATE_LIMITS = {
    "druwyn": 2,
    "quenael": 10,
    "wenix": 2,
    "druael": 2,
}

# Taxcache — Environments

Taxcache keeps jurisdiction tax rates warm so checkout doesn't hit the upstream registry on every call. We run three environments: dev (in-memory only), staging (shared cluster, short TTLs), and prod (replicated, long TTLs). Staging is the one you'll touch most. Staging currently runs with the following configuration values.

config for kajog-tadug:
[casax]
port = 11211
region = west-3
host = casax.nelvroworks.internal
timeout_ms = 5000
retries = 7